Basketball Digest, May, 2001
1. Five players have scored 30-plus pints in every game of an NBA Finals series. Can you name them? And can you name the player with the top scoring average in Finals play?
2. Nearly half of the 26 games of 50-plus points in playoff history have been accomplished by two players. Name them.
3. Two players have recorded 40-plus rebounds in a playoff game. Who are they?
4. Can you name the two players who account for more than three-quarters of the 17 20-plus assists games in the playoffs?
5. Only one player has shot 60% or better from the floor in his playoff career. Only one player has shot 50% or better from the arc in his playoff career. Can you name them?
6. Who passed Michael Jordan last year for first place on the all-time postseason steals list?
7. What team that has won at least one playoff game has the lowest all-time postseason winning percentage?
8. Match the player to his playoff distinction:
1. Michael Jordan a. Most consecutive 40-plus scoring games (6) 2. Elgin Baylor b. Most consecutive 30-plus scoring games (11) 3. Jerry West c. Most consecutive 20-plus scoring games (60)
9. A Los Angeles Laker holds the distinction of being disqualified from a game fastest in playoff history. Was it Shaquille O'Neal, Jamaal Wilkes, Travis Knight, Sedale Threatt, Happy Hairston, Kareem Abdul-Jabbar, Pat Riley, or A.C. Green?
10. Has a team ever gone an entire playoff game without recording a blocked shot?
Quick Quiz Answers
1. Elgin Baylor (1962), Rick Barry (1967), Michael Jordan (1993), Hakeem Olajuwon (1995), and Shaquille O'Neal (2000). Of the five, Barry holds the top scoring average in Finals play, 36.3. 2. Wilt Chamberlain scored 50-plus eight times, Michael Jordan four times. 3. Bill Russell gathered 40 rebounds in a game three times, but Wilt Chamberlain holds the all-time playoff mark with 41 vs. Russell on April 5, 1967. 4. Magic Johnson had 10 games of 20-plus assists in the playoffs, while John Stockton has four. 5. James Donaldson shot 62.7% in the postseason, while Bobby Hansen shot 50% from the three-point line. 6. Jordan's teammate Scottie Pippen's 383 steals rank first on the all-time list. Jordan, with 376, ranks second. 7. The New Jersey Nets are 9-30 in postseason play, for an NBA-worst .231 winning percentage. The Toronto Raptors are 0-3 in postseason play. 8. 1-c, 2-b, 3-a 9. Travis Knight was tossed from a game vs. the San Antonio Spurs on May 23, 1999, after playing only six minutes. 10. Yes. In fact, it's happened 47 times in postseason history. Photo: Eric "Sleepy" Floyd holds the record for most points scored in one quarter of a playoff game, with 29 vs. the Los Angeles Lakers on May 10, 1987.
